The Restaurant Spending Index that’s part of the Consumer Spending Report by Chain Store Guide continued in the same narrow band it has the past six months. It ticked down to 114.1 compared with 116.3 in October, 117.2 in September, and115.8 in August. The index is based on a survey of consumers’ eating-out intentions and…
